Access a personalised study list, thousands of test questions, grammar lessons and reading, writing and … WebApr 23, 2012 · 3. 8.1 Preterite of stem-changing verbs Stem-changing –ir verbs, in the preterite only, have a stem change in the third-person singular and plural forms. The stem change consists of either e to i or o to u. (e→i) pedir : pidió, pidieron (o →u) morir (to die) : murió, murieron.
